Output c86aaae161e5e72a012d64c92d19dfde6dca03ef57fd73a6750bc16e408e0b49:1

value
8582883
script pubkey
OP_0 OP_PUSHBYTES_20 1873ad7722b8cd62f45c11ae1f61816f85a06a5f
address
bc1qrpe66aezhrxk9azuzxhp7cvpd7z6q6jl8vd7gx
transaction
c86aaae161e5e72a012d64c92d19dfde6dca03ef57fd73a6750bc16e408e0b49
confirmations
123065
spent
true